Search Constraints

Search Results

  • Big Ben from west

  • Charing Cross LONDON

  • Pont Street Chelsea, London

  • Henekeys in the Strand

  • Constitution Club on Northumberland Ave.

  • Big Ben

  • Big Ben

  • The Hippodrome on Leicester Square London

  • Hippodrome  Leicester Square London

  • St. Pancras station